In the current political debate, theater buildings are under fire not only in Stuttgart. The renovation of aging theaters across Germany is inevitable. However, funding for education and culture should not be pitted against one another, as is unfortunately the case in the public discourse. The symposium’s approach is therefore to discuss the best possible implementation strategies for cultural buildings in order to meet cost, schedule, and quality requirements. The symposium will focus on various contract models, using examples from Cologne, Kassel, Nuremberg, Stuttgart, Munich, Karlsruhe, and other cities. A wide range of representatives from the individual projects have already confirmed their participation (clients, client representatives, planners, project managers, construction companies, users, lawyers, cultural professionals, etc.).
